Hosting Glossary

RAM (Memory)

Temporary storage used by your server to handle active requests and run applications. More RAM allows for more concurrent visitors without slowdowns.

NVMe SSD Storage

The fastest type of modern storage. NVMe (Non-Volatile Memory Express) is significantly faster than standard SATA SSDs, leading to faster website load times.

Intro vs Renewal Price

Intro pricing is a promotional rate for the first term. Renewal pricing is the standard rate you will pay after the initial period ends.

Which hosting type is right for me? +

Use **Shared** for small blogs, **VPS** for growing sites that need dedicated resources, and **Dedicated** for high-traffic enterprise applications.
